Oracle CRS 时区设置指南(Oracle crs时区)
Oracle CRS 时区设置指南
Oracle Clusterware (CRS) 是一个组成 Oracle 产品家族的重要组件之一。它是 Oracle 集群环境的基础,用于管理集群中的资源、实现自动故障切换和高可用性等功能。而在 Oracle CRS 中,时区设置是非常重要的一项操作,因为不合理的时区设置可能会导致集群中的节点之间时间不一致,进而导致资源无法访问或故障切换失败等问题。因此,本文将介绍如何在 Oracle CRS 中正确设置时区。
1. 确认当前时区
在设置时区之前,首先需要确认当前系统的时区设置。可以使用以下命令查看:
“`bash
$ date +%Z
如果输出结果是 UTC,则表示当前系统时区为协调世界时(Coordinated Universal Time),也称为格林威治标准时间(Greenwich Mean Time,简称 GMT)。一般来说,UTC/GMT 都是作为统一的参考时区,其他时区都是根据 UTC/GMT 进行计算的。
2. 修改时区
在修改时区之前,需要备份 /etc/localtime 文件,以便恢复。可以使用以下命令备份:
```bash$ cp /etc/localtime /etc/localtime.bak
然后可以使用以下命令修改时区,以 Asia/Shangh 为例:
“`bash
$ ln -sf /usr/share/zoneinfo/Asia/Shangh /etc/localtime
修改完成后,可以使用以下命令验证新的时区设置:
```bash$ date
如果输出结果与本地时间一致,则表示时区修改成功。
3. 将时区同步到 Oracle CRS 中
在修改系统时区后,还需要将新的时区信息同步到 Oracle CRS 中。可以使用以下命令修改:
“`bash
$ crsctl set css attribute CSS_CRS_TIMEZONE=
其中, 是新的时区值,例如 Asia/Shangh。
4. 验证时区设置
需要验证新的时区设置是否生效。可以使用以下命令查看:
```bash$ crsctl query css attribute CSS_CRS_TIMEZONE
如果输出结果与修改的时区一致,则表示时区设置成功。
总结
正确设置时区在 Oracle CRS 中至关重要,它不仅能够保证集群节点之间的时间一致性,还能够避免各种故障和异常情况。本文介绍了如何修改系统时区、将时区同步到 Oracle CRS 中,并验证新的时区设置是否生效。希望能够对使用 Oracle CRS 的用户有所帮助。